This local tradition will have you donning your snorkel gear and jumping in to enjoy what has been likened to a "salt water scavenger hunt" or "underwater easter egg hunt".  These tasty mollusks seat themselves in the grass beds in and around

Crystal River and Homosassa.  You simply snorkel around searching for your savory treasures... pick them up and

place them in your mesh scallop bag!  It's that easy. You will also enjoy viewing a wide variety of fish, sea stars, sponges and coral on your scalloping excursion.

Scallop charters do not include scallop cleaning, but you are welcome to clean your own. (We are happy to teach you.) Or, there are professional scallop cleaners at key locations who will clean your scallops for a nominal fee. (Rates range from $25- $35 per 5 gallon bucket.)
